The F7 is Cordoba’s entry-level flamenco guitar featuring the traditional combination of a solid European spruce top paired with cypress back and sides. It’s a perfect fit for both beginner and intermediate flamenco players. Incredibly lightweight, the F7 is built in the Spanish tradition with a slightly thinner body depth than a classical guitar. Additionally, its flat neck angle gives this guitar low action, and the bright, snappy tone characteristic of flamenco guitars. A clear flamenco-style tap plate comes installed on the top for an added layer of protection and like all Córdoba guitars, the F7 includes a two-way truss rod inside the neck for action adjustment and long term stability. Iberia Series
| Body Top | Solid European Spruce |
|---|---|
| Upper Bout Width | 286mm (11 1/4″) |
| Lower Bout Width | 368mm (14 1/2″) |
| Body Depth Upper Bout | 85mm (3 1/3″) |
| Body Depth Lower Bout | 90mm (3 1/2″) |
| Body Length | 489mm (19 1/4″) |
| Overall Length | 984mm (38 3/4″) |
| Soundhole Diameter | 84mm (3 1/3″) |
| Top Bracing Pattern | Fan |
| Back and Sides Wood | Cypress |
| Top Binding | Rosewood |
| Rosette | All Wood Traditional |
| Top Purfling Inlay | Maple and Black |
| Bridge Material | Rosewood |
| Saddle Material | Bone |
| Scale Length | 650mm (25 1/2″) |
| Neck Material | Mahogany |
| Fingerboard Material | Rosewood |
| Nut Width | 52mm (2″) |
| Nut Material | Bone |
| Truss Rod | Dual Action |
| Truss Rod Wrench | 4mm Allen Key |
| Neck Thickness 1st Fret | 21mm |
| Neck Thickness 9th Fret | 24mm |
| Frets Total | 19 |
| Tuning Machines | Cordoba Gold and Black with Black Buttons |
| Neck Shape | C Shape |
| Finish | Gloss Polyurethane |
| Color | Natural (NAT) |
| Tap Plate | Yes |
| Strings | Savarez Cristal Corum High Tension 500CJ |
| Included Case | Cordoba Deluxe Gig Bag |
